Java編程開發工程師如何完美優化網站排名

一、關鍵字選擇

在網站優化中,關鍵字的選擇非常重要。Java編程開發工程師在選擇關鍵字時要根據網站的主題、目標受眾、競爭度等方面進行綜合考慮。

首先,要選擇和網站主題相關的關鍵字。比如,如果是一個Java編程開發的教學網站,可以選擇「Java教程」、「Java編程」等關鍵字。其次,要選擇有一定熱度的關鍵字,即關鍵字的搜索量要比較大。同時,還要注意關鍵字的競爭度,避免選擇太過熱門的關鍵字難以排名。最後,要根據目標受眾的特點選擇關鍵字。

public class KeywordSelection {
    String[] keywords = {"Java教程", "Java編程", "Java實戰", "Java開發"};
    int[] searchVolume = {100000, 80000, 50000, 30000};
    int[] competition = {70, 60, 65, 50};
    String[] targetAudience = {"初學者", "中級開發工程師", "高級開發工程師"};

    public String[] selectKeywords(String targetAudience) {
        List selectedKeywords = new ArrayList();
        for (int i = 0; i  50000 && competition[i]  80000 && competition[i]  30000 && competition[i] < 60) {
                selectedKeywords.add(keywords[i]);
            }
        }
        return selectedKeywords.toArray(new String[selectedKeywords.size()]);
    }
}

二、網站內容優化

網站內容的質量是影響網站排名的重要因素之一。Java編程開發工程師需要注意以下幾點:

1、網站內容要豐富。要提供豐富的Java編程開發資訊、教程、案例等內容,讓用戶可以在網站上獲取到全面的Java編程開發知識。

2、網站內容要時常更新。Google等搜索引擎更喜歡更新頻繁的網站。Java編程開發工程師可以通過發布最新的Java編程開發資訊、技巧、案例等,讓網站內容更具活力。

3、網站內容要優化關鍵字密度。要在網站內容中合理地安排關鍵字的使用,避免過度使用導致被搜索引擎判定為作弊行為。

public class ContentOptimization {
    // 獲取網站文章
    public String[] getArticles() {
        //TODO
    }

    // 關鍵字優化
    public void optimizeKeywords(String[] keywords) {
        String[] articles = getArticles();
        for (String article : articles) {
            for (String keyword : keywords) {
                int count = countKeyword(article, keyword);
                if (count > 0) {
                    article = article.replaceAll(keyword, "" + keyword + "");
                }
            }

            // 更新文章
            //TODO
        }
    }

    // 統計關鍵字出現次數
    private int countKeyword(String article, String keyword) {
        int count = 0;
        int index = 0;
        while ((index = article.indexOf(keyword, index)) != -1) {
            count++;
            index += keyword.length();
        }
        return count;
    }
}

三、網站結構優化

網站結構的合理設計有助於提升網站排名。Java編程開發工程師可以採取以下措施:

1、使用SEO友好的URL結構。對於Java編程開發的教學網站,可以採用「Java教程/文集/Java基礎」這樣的URL結構。

2、清晰的網站結構導航。通過合理的網站結構導航,讓搜索引擎可以快速地了解網站的內容結構。

3、合理的內部鏈接。在網站內部,Java編程開發工程師可以通過合理的內部鏈接,讓搜索引擎更方便地抓取網站內容。

public class SiteStructureOptimization {
    // 生成SEO友好的URL
    public String generateFriendlyUrl(String url) {
        //TODO
    }

    // 生成網站結構導航
    public String generateSiteNavigation() {
        //TODO
    }

    // 內部鏈接
    public void generateInternalLinks() {
        //TODO
    }
}

四、網站性能優化

網站性能對於用戶體驗和搜索引擎排名都非常重要。Java編程開發工程師可以從以下幾個方面進行優化:

1、優化網站載入速度。通過使用CDN、壓縮圖片等方式,減少網站頁面載入時間。

2、優化網站代碼。對網站的HTML、CSS、JavaScript等代碼進行優化,減少代碼冗餘,提高網站運行效率。

3、使用適當的緩存機制。Java編程開發工程師可以使用緩存來減少伺服器的壓力,提高網站的響應速度,從而提高網站的訪問速度和用戶體驗。

public class SitePerformanceOptimization {
    // 載入時間優化
    public void optimizePageLoadTime() {
        //TODO
    }

    // 代碼優化
    public void optimizeCode() {
        //TODO
    }

    // 緩存優化
    public void optimizeCache() {
        //TODO
    }
}

原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/150708.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
小藍的頭像小藍
上一篇 2024-11-09 02:13
下一篇 2024-11-09 02:13

相關推薦

發表回復

登錄後才能評論